© 2022 Ecolibrium Inc. | Registered in Delaware, USA Nº 5547793 | All Rights Reserved


Bold challengers and change makers, we are the pioneers striving for a better world.


See the latest roles available

This is where
change happens.

We love working with smart thinkers, multi-disciplinary doers and, generally people who exist to make a difference. We are where passion and expertise meet to build the power of connected technologies across numerous global industries.

Our Philosophy

Sustainable Prosperity - People, Planet, Profit. Neither is more important than the other - each must receive equal emphasis and priority. Ecolibrium is here to create a sustainable balance between forward progress and future well-being.